Completed: The Inquisitor's Key
3 Stars, because I love the series.
It was just meh, for me. This could have been so interesting, but the overtures of romance amongst colleagues was ad nauseam. The childish banter and jealousy from Dr Brockton, is just stupid. The scientific stuff was okay and the rare moments of mystery and tension; but this was just a poor entry in the series.

Completed: The Hanging Garden
3.5 Stars
This was decent; but not the usual police procedural and action that we normally get with Rebus. I think there were too many cases going all at once; even though they all tied in together; it was just too much. It was enjoyable, as usual. Rebus is a mess, but not as broken as Bosch or Harry Hole.
Decent entry, but I am hoping we get back to the police procedural that we know and love.

Completed: Dead Souls
4 Stars
Great pacing, and per usual; there are many separate mysteries going on, with 1 commonality. This one did not leave me frustrated with Rebus' decisions. Also, he encountered a foe (Oakes) that was hard to figure out. I don't think Rebus ever fully understood true motives, end-game, etc with Oakes. I know I didn't.
There were some resolutions, but nothing is ever tidy with Rebus and the criminals he deals with.

Completed: The Terror
3.5 Stars
Just because I gave this 3.5 Stars, doesn't mean I didn't like it. I enjoyed it ... mostly; but it was dense; my God, was it dense. Everyone has an opinion and a tale to tell, in this novel.
The NY Times said it best about the length: "Where are we going and why, and will the whole grueling experience be worth it? Or are we just stuck in something we can’t seem to get out of?"
I kept wondering what is the ultimate end to this?? Will this NF crew get saved; unlike, the real crew?? Will there be retribution, safe passage or at least revenge for the survivors of man and beast?? The end did not justify the means, for me. It seemed quite ant-climactic and seemed to lose steam once the crew had a reckoning.
Dan Simmons knows how to write, so I really enjoyed all of the writing; it was just too much. I loved the descriptions of what the crews were up against and I was hungry, cold and bewildered; just like them. I felt all of it, and you will too.
I do recommend the reading of this book; I just don't highly recommend it.
